Subject: Template cut-over done

Hi support crew,

We flipped the Petalwick mailer over to the new rendering engine last night. Render times dropped from ~900ms to under 120ms, and the queue backlog cleared by morning. If customers mention odd spacing in footers, tag it "render-v2". For reference, the service now runs with these settings.

config for kajog-tadug:
[casax]
port = 11211
region = west-3
host = casax.nelvroworks.internal
timeout_ms = 5000
retries = 7

// Threshold for the Millbrook customer-record dedup pass.
// Records scoring above this are auto-merged; below it, they
// land in the support review queue. Do NOT lower this without
// checking with the data team — last time it was dropped to 0.80,
// two unrelated accounts in the Harwick region got merged and
// support spent a week untangling billing. Raising it is safer
// but floods the review queue. Current value was validated against
// the September sample set. The validation build is recorded below.

build token for kagaf-hahof: htk14_9d3d4d26d7d8de

Clock skew between Hartlow build agents causes intermittent signing failures when timestamps drift more than 90 seconds. If the Verdant pipeline reports a stale-certificate error, first compare agent clocks via the fleet dashboard rather than restarting jobs. Agents in the Kellerby rack are the usual offenders after power maintenance. Force an NTP resync on the affected agent, then requeue only the failed stage. Confirm the fix by checking the most recent passing run's trace token below.

pipeline stamp: htk9_ce63042d9

Q3 review complete. Discounts above 12% on Veltrix Pro deals now require regional sign-off; above 18%, central finance approval. Branch-level exceptions are suspended until further notice. Marholt branch exceeded policy on four deals last quarter, costing roughly 40k in margin. Corrective training runs next month. Deal desk turnaround remains 48 hours; do not promise faster to close. Compliance will be audited quarterly and results shared with regional directors. Context for these changes is summarised in the note below.

board note of baweg-bawig: Project Tamath slips by six weeks because of the audit delay.